The Radeon R7 250 is a clear winner – it's at least 2x faster gaming GPU than the GeForce 210 and it's also a much better value for money, as it's $11.75 cheaper!
Advantages of the Radeon R7 250
- At least 2x faster GPU for gaming
- Up to 15% cheaper – $67.55 vs $79.30
- A much better value for money for gaming
- Up to 100% more VRAM memory – 1 vs 0 GB
Advantages of the GeForce 210
- Consumes up to 44% less energy – 31 vs 55 Watts

Specifications
Comparison of all specifications
Radeon R7 250 | SpecificationsComparison of all specifications | GeForce 210 |
---|---|---|
General | ||
Oct 8th, 2013 | Release Date | Oct 12th, 2009 |
Not Available | MSRP | Not Available |
Volcanic Islands | Generation | GeForce 200 |
Desktop | Segment | Desktop |
55 W | Power Consumption | 31 W |
Memory | ||
1 GB | Memory Size | 0.5 GB |
DDR3 | Memory Type | DDR3 |
128-bit | Memory Bus | 64-bit |
28.8 GB/s | Bandwidth | 6.4 GB/s |
Theoretical Performance | ||
14.8 GPixel/s | Pixel Fillrate | 2.08 GPixel/s |
29.6 GTexel/s | Texture Fillrate | 4.16 GTexel/s |
947.2 GFLOPS | FP32 | 39.36 GFLOPS |
